Over 25.9 mln recover from COVID-19 in India



NEW DELHI: The number of coronavirus cases in the southern neigbor India has come down, of late.

India recorded 126,698 new coronavirus cases in the last 24 hours, taking the caseload to 28,173,655.

Earlier, the daily number of cases of COVID-19 had gone up to 400,000.

Currently, 1,902,242 are undergoing treatment at various isolation centers and hospitals. Meanwhile, 25,939,504 have returned home after treatment.

Similarly, the number of deaths from the coronavirus in India has crossed the 329,100-mark.

With 2,782 deaths in a single day, the number of deaths from the virus has reached 331,909, according to the latest figures collated by the Worldometers.

Broken out in Wuhan City of China in December 2019, the coronavirus has killed 3,564,524 and infected 171,384,990 globally until the filing of this news.
